Report: Bin Laden ‘within reach’ in ’01

From: The Washington Times | November 30, 2009 

Osama bin Laden was unquestionably within reach of U.S. troops in the mountains of Tora Bora when American military leaders decided not to pursue the terrorist leader with massive force in 2001, says a report by Senate Democrats. The report asserts that the failure to kill or capture bin Laden at his most vulnerable, in December 2001, has had lasting consequences beyond the fate of one man, saying his escape laid the foundation for today's reinvigorated Afghan insurgency and inflamed the internal strife now endangering Pakistan.
